Handshake is seeking Set and Exhibit Designers to contribute to an AI training project. You'll leverage your professional experience to evaluate AI models and provide feedback. No AI experience is required, making this an accessible opportunity for those with relevant design backgrounds.
You have at least 4 years of professional experience in set and exhibit design or related fields. Your background includes developing set designs based on scripts, budgets, and available locations. You are comfortable preparing rough drafts and scale working drawings of sets, including floor plans, scenery, and props. You possess the ability to create preliminary renderings that effectively communicate your design ideas. You are detail-oriented and can deliver clear, structured feedback that strengthens AI models' understanding of workplace tasks and language. You are open to learning new skills and adapting to the evolving landscape of AI in your field. You are flexible and can work independently, managing your time effectively to meet project demands.
In this role, you will contribute to an hourly, temporary AI research project by evaluating AI models and assessing content related to your field of work. You will develop prompts for AI models that reflect your expertise and evaluate the responses generated by these models. Your feedback will play a crucial role in enhancing the AI's understanding of set and exhibit design tasks. The position is remote and asynchronous, allowing you to work independently from wherever you are.
